Farbiger Text: Unterschied zwischen den Versionen
Aus RailRoad&Co.-Wiki
Zur Navigation springenZur Suche springen
Uslex (Diskussion | Beiträge) K Farbiger Text |
Uslex (Diskussion | Beiträge) K Bereitete die Seite zur Übersetzung vor |
||
| Zeile 1: | Zeile 1: | ||
<languages/> | |||
{{TC910g}} | {{TC910g}} | ||
<translate> | |||
__NOTOC__ | __NOTOC__ | ||
== Farbiger Text in Traincontroller == | |||
=== Farbe in Abhängigkeit einer Variablen === | === Farbe in Abhängigkeit einer Variablen === | ||
Ich möchte die Farbe eines Zählers (Variable "aktive Zugfahrten") von grün auf rot wechseln, wenn die Variable kleiner als 1 (oder grösser 0) ist. | Ich möchte die Farbe eines Zählers (Variable "aktive Zugfahrten") von grün auf rot wechseln, wenn die Variable kleiner als 1 (oder grösser 0) ist. | ||
:[[Datei:Farbiger-Text.png|400px]] | :</translate> | ||
[[Datei:Farbiger-Text.png|<translate>400px</translate>]] | |||
<translate> | |||
:''Abb: Farbiger Text'' | :''Abb: Farbiger Text'' | ||
Wie muss ich da vorgehen? | Wie muss ich da vorgehen? | ||
| Zeile 36: | Zeile 42: | ||
</html> | </html> | ||
</pre> | </pre> | ||
=== Praktische Verwendung in TrainController === | === Praktische Verwendung in TrainController === | ||
Silvio Richter stellt dieses Beispiel als Anlagendatei: [[Medium:farbiger_text.zip|farbiger_text.zip]] zur Verfügung: | Silvio Richter stellt dieses Beispiel als Anlagendatei: [[Special:MyLanguage/Medium:farbiger_text.zip|farbiger_text.zip]] zur Verfügung: | ||
:</translate> | |||
[[Datei:Textelement-farbig.png|<translate>400px</translate>]] | |||
<translate> | |||
:''Abb: Farbiges Textelement'' | :''Abb: Farbiges Textelement'' | ||
== Weblinks == | |||
*Quelle: [https://www.freiwald.com/forum/viewtopic.php?p=275415#p275415 Forum] | *Quelle: [https://www.freiwald.com/forum/viewtopic.php?p=275415#p275415 Forum] | ||
*Anlagendatei: [[Medium:farbiger_text.zip|farbiger_text.zip]] | *Anlagendatei: [[Special:MyLanguage/Medium:farbiger_text.zip|farbiger_text.zip]] | ||
*TC-wiki: [[Fahrzeit ermitteln mittels Variablen|Fahrzeit ermitteln mittels Variablen]] | *TC-wiki: [[Special:MyLanguage/Fahrzeit ermitteln mittels Variablen|Fahrzeit ermitteln mittels Variablen]] | ||
:-- [[Benutzer:Uslex|Uslex]] ([[Benutzer Diskussion:Uslex|Diskussion]]) 16:13, 7. Aug. 2025 (CEST) | :-- [[Special:MyLanguage/Benutzer:Uslex|Uslex]] ([[Benutzer Diskussion:Uslex|Diskussion]]) 16:13, 7. Aug. 2025 (CEST) | ||
</translate> | |||
[[Kategorie: Software{{#translation:}}]] | [[Kategorie: Software{{#translation:}}]] | ||
[[Kategorie: TrainController{{#translation:}}]] | [[Kategorie: TrainController{{#translation:}}]] | ||
[[Kategorie: Variablen]] | [[Kategorie: Variablen{{#translation:}}]] | ||
Version vom 7. August 2025, 14:15 Uhr
Farbiger Text in Traincontroller
Farbe in Abhängigkeit einer Variablen
Ich möchte die Farbe eines Zählers (Variable "aktive Zugfahrten") von grün auf rot wechseln, wenn die Variable kleiner als 1 (oder grösser 0) ist.
- Abb: Farbiger Text
Wie muss ich da vorgehen?
HTML in Textelementen
Herr Freiwald beschreibt das Vorgehen im Forum:
- Es wird nur ein "vereinfachtes" HTML für die Darstellung von Text verwendet.
- Es genügt, den Text in <html>...</html> einzuschließen.
- Tags wie <!DOCTYPE html>, <head>, <title> oder <body> werden nicht benötigt. Es gibt ja praktisch nur den Body.
- <... style="..."> kann jedoch verwendet werden.
Mit der Verwendung von Variablen im Style-Bereich kann die Darstellung des Texts sehr gut dynamisiert werden (z.B. für Farbwechsel, Unsichtbar-Schalten, usw.)
HTML Beispiel
Hier die notwendigen Befehle ohne Tags wie <!DOCTYPE html>, <head>, <title> oder <body>
<html> <p style="color: black;">Schriftfarbe schwarz</p> <p style="color: red;">Schriftfarbe rot</p> </html>
Praktische Verwendung in TrainController
Silvio Richter stellt dieses Beispiel als Anlagendatei: farbiger_text.zip zur Verfügung:
- Abb: Farbiges Textelement
Weblinks
- Quelle: Forum
- Anlagendatei: farbiger_text.zip
- TC-wiki: Fahrzeit ermitteln mittels Variablen
- -- Uslex (Diskussion) 16:13, 7. Aug. 2025 (CEST)